Commit ba5cc967 authored by Aurel's avatar Aurel

$ symbol needs to be escaped with Chameleon; more

parent e0f61538
......@@ -59,7 +59,7 @@
<!-- Set an URL of ERP5 so test do not depend on external RSS provider -->
<tr>
<td>click</td>
<td>//div[@id='${erp5_rss_box_id}']/h3/span/a[2]</td>
<td>//div[@id='&#36;erp5_rss_box_id}']/h3/span/a[2]</td>
<td></td>
</tr>
<tr>
......
......@@ -78,7 +78,7 @@ Wait for activities</span>
</tr>
<tr>
<td>click</td>
<td>//div[@id='${erp5_persons_box_id}']/h3/span/a[2]</td>
<td>//div[@id='&#36;erp5_persons_box_id}']/h3/span/a[2]</td>
<td></td>
</tr>
<tr>
......@@ -103,7 +103,7 @@ Wait for activities</span>
</tr>
<tr>
<td>click</td>
<td>//div[@id='${erp5_web_section_random_page_box_id}']/h3/span/a[2]</td>
<td>//div[@id='&#36;erp5_web_section_random_page_box_id}']/h3/span/a[2]</td>
<td></td>
</tr>
<tr>
......@@ -130,7 +130,7 @@ Wait for activities</span>
<!-- Edit gadget form submit by pressing enter -->
<tr>
<td>click</td>
<td>//div[@id='${erp5_web_section_random_page_box_id}']/h3/span/a[2]</td>
<td>//div[@id='&#36;erp5_web_section_random_page_box_id}']/h3/span/a[2]</td>
<td></td>
</tr>
<tr>
......@@ -165,7 +165,7 @@ Wait for activities</span>
</tr>
<tr>
<td>click</td>
<td>//div[@id='${erp5_web_section_random_page_box_id}']/h3/span/a[1]</td>
<td>//div[@id='&#36;erp5_web_section_random_page_box_id}']/h3/span/a[1]</td>
<td></td>
</tr>
<tr>
......
......@@ -325,7 +325,7 @@
</tr>
<tr>
<td>waitForElementPresent</td>
<td>//input[@value='${cloned_title}']</td>
<td>//input[@value='&#36;cloned_title}']</td>
<td></td>
</tr>
<tr>
......
......@@ -325,7 +325,7 @@
</tr>
<tr>
<td>waitForElementPresent</td>
<td>//input[@value='${cloned_title}']</td>
<td>//input[@value='&#36;cloned_title}']</td>
<td></td>
</tr>
<tr>
......
......@@ -325,7 +325,7 @@
</tr>
<tr>
<td>waitForElementPresent</td>
<td>//input[@value='${cloned_title}']</td>
<td>//input[@value='&#36;cloned_title}']</td>
<td></td>
</tr>
<tr>
......
......@@ -327,7 +327,7 @@
</tr>
<tr>
<td>waitForElementPresent</td>
<td>//input[@value='${cloned_title}']</td>
<td>//input[@value='&#36;cloned_title}']</td>
<td></td>
</tr>
<tr>
......
......@@ -317,7 +317,7 @@
</tr>
<tr>
<td>waitForElementPresent</td>
<td>//input[@value='${cloned_title}']</td>
<td>//input[@value='&#36;cloned_title}']</td>
<td></td>
</tr>
<tr>
......
......@@ -327,7 +327,7 @@
</tr>
<tr>
<td>waitForElementPresent</td>
<td>//input[@value='${cloned_title}']</td>
<td>//input[@value='&#36;cloned_title}']</td>
<td></td>
</tr>
<tr>
......
......@@ -325,7 +325,7 @@
</tr>
<tr>
<td>waitForElementPresent</td>
<td>//input[@value='${cloned_title}']</td>
<td>//input[@value='&#36;cloned_title}']</td>
<td></td>
</tr>
<tr>
......
......@@ -315,7 +315,7 @@
</tr>
<tr>
<td>waitForElementPresent</td>
<td>//input[@value='${cloned_title}']</td>
<td>//input[@value='&#36;cloned_title}']</td>
<td></td>
</tr>
<tr>
......
......@@ -325,7 +325,7 @@
</tr>
<tr>
<td>waitForElementPresent</td>
<td>//input[@value='${cloned_title}']</td>
<td>//input[@value='&#36;cloned_title}']</td>
<td></td>
</tr>
<tr>
......
......@@ -325,7 +325,7 @@
</tr>
<tr>
<td>waitForElementPresent</td>
<td>//input[@value='${cloned_title}']</td>
<td>//input[@value='&#36;cloned_title}']</td>
<td></td>
</tr>
<tr>
......
......@@ -261,7 +261,7 @@
</tr>
<tr>
<td>waitForElementPresent</td>
<td>//input[@value='${title}']</td>
<td>//input[@value='&#36;title}']</td>
<td></td>
</tr>
<tr>
......
......@@ -387,7 +387,7 @@
</tr>
<tr>
<td>waitForElementPresent</td>
<td>//a[@data-i18n='${hosting_title}']</td>
<td>//a[@data-i18n='&#36;hosting_title}']</td>
<td></td>
</tr>
<tr>
......@@ -467,7 +467,7 @@
</tr>
<tr>
<td>waitForElementPresent</td>
<td>//a[@data-i18n='${hosting_title}']</td>
<td>//a[@data-i18n='&#36;hosting_title}']</td>
<td></td>
</tr>
<tr>
......
......@@ -33,9 +33,9 @@ b
<td>//div[@data-role='header']//h1/a</td><td></td></tr>
<tal:block metal:use-macro="here/Zuite_CommonTemplateForRenderjsUi/macros/wait_for_content_loaded" />
<tr><td>waitForElementP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_field_listbox.html']//table/tbody/tr</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_field_listbox.html']//table/tbody/tr</td><td></td></tr>
<tr><td>click</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_field_listbox.html']//table/tbody/tr[1]//a</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_field_listbox.html']//table/tbody/tr[1]//a</td><td></td></tr>
<tr><td>waitForElementPresent</td>
<td>//div[@data-gadget-url="${renderjs_url}/gadget_erp5_field_lines.html"]//textarea</td><td></td></tr>
<tr><td>assertValue</td>
......
......@@ -49,9 +49,9 @@ Frontend should not suppose default sorting
<!-- Make sure broken definitions don't appear in sort editor -->
<tal:block metal:use-macro="here/Zuite_CommonTemplateForRenderjsUi/macros/triggle_sort" />
<tr><td>waitForElementP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_sort_editor.html']//button[@class="plus ui-icon-plus ui-btn-icon-left"]</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_sort_editor.html']//button[@class="plus ui-icon-plus ui-btn-icon-left"]</td><td></td></tr>
<tr><td>assertElementNotP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_sort_editor.html']//select</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_sort_editor.html']//select</td><td></td></tr>
<!-- Let's set up the default sort correctly: id | ASC -->
<tr><td>open</td>
......
......@@ -30,12 +30,12 @@
<tr>
<td>assertElementP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_pt_form_view.html']</td>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_pt_form_view.html']</td>
<td></td>
</tr>
<tr>
<td>verifyElementNotP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_pt_form_view_editable.html']</td>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_pt_form_view_editable.html']</td>
<td></td>
</tr>
......@@ -52,7 +52,7 @@
<!-- Textarea must be editable -->
<tr>
<td>type</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_pt_form_dialog.html']//textarea</td>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_pt_form_dialog.html']//textarea</td>
<td>QWERTY</td>
</tr>
......@@ -65,12 +65,12 @@
<tr>
<td>assertElementP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_pt_form_view.html']</td>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_pt_form_view.html']</td>
<td></td>
</tr>
<tr>
<td>verifyElementNotP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_pt_form_view_editable.html']</td>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_pt_form_view_editable.html']</td>
<td></td>
</tr>
</tbody></table>
......
......@@ -23,15 +23,15 @@
<td>&#36;{renderjs_url}/#/foo_module/1?editable=true</td><td></td></tr>
<tal:block metal:use-macro="here/Zuite_CommonTemplateForRenderjsUi/macros/wait_for_app_loaded" />
<tr><td>assertElementP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_pt_form_view_editable.html']</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_pt_form_view_editable.html']</td><td></td></tr>
<tr><td>verifyElementNotP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_pt_form_view.html']</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_pt_form_view.html']</td><td></td></tr>
<tal:block metal:use-macro="here/Zuite_CommonTemplateForRenderjsUi/macros/go_to_foo_relation_field_view" />
<tr><td>assertElementP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_pt_form_view_editable.html']</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_pt_form_view_editable.html']</td><td></td></tr>
<tr><td>verifyElementNotP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_pt_form_view.html']</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_pt_form_view.html']</td><td></td></tr>
<!-- Unsuccessful save does not mingle with editability -->
<tal:block metal:use-macro="here/Zuite_CommonTemplateForRenderjsUi/macros/click_save" />
......@@ -41,9 +41,9 @@
</tal:block>
<tr><td>waitForElementP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_pt_form_view_editable.html']</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_pt_form_view_editable.html']</td><td></td></tr>
<tr><td>verifyElementNotP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_pt_form_view.html']</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_pt_form_view.html']</td><td></td></tr>
<!-- Successful save does not mingle with editability -->
<tr><td>waitForElementPresent</td>
......@@ -76,9 +76,9 @@
<tal:block metal:use-macro="here/Zuite_CommonTemplateForRenderjsUi/macros/save" />
<tr><td>waitForElementP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_pt_form_view_editable.html']</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_pt_form_view_editable.html']</td><td></td></tr>
<tr><td>verifyElementNotP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_pt_form_view.html']</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_pt_form_view.html']</td><td></td></tr>
<!-- Passing through action does not mingle with editability -->
<tal:block tal:define="click_configuration python: {'text': 'Actions'}">
......@@ -93,7 +93,7 @@
<!-- Textarea must be editable -->
<tr><td>type</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_pt_form_dialog.html']//textarea</td>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_pt_form_dialog.html']//textarea</td>
<td>QWERTY</td></tr>
<tal:block metal:use-macro="here/Zuite_CommonTemplateForRenderjsUi/macros/submit_dialog" />
......@@ -102,9 +102,9 @@
<tal:block metal:use-macro="here/Zuite_CommonTemplateForRenderjsUi/macros/wait_for_notification" />
</tal:block>
<tr><td>waitForElementP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_pt_form_view_editable.html']</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_pt_form_view_editable.html']</td><td></td></tr>
<tr><td>verifyElementNotP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_pt_form_view.html']</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_pt_form_view.html']</td><td></td></tr>
</tbody></table>
</body>
......
......@@ -35,7 +35,7 @@
<!-- Wait for gadget to be loaded -->
<tr>
<td>waitForElementPresent</td>
<td>//div[@data-gadget-url='${runner_url}gadget_erp5_panel.html']//div[@data-gadget-url='${runner_url}gadget_erp5_searchfield.html']</td>
<td>//div[@data-gadget-url='&#36;runner_url}gadget_erp5_panel.html']//div[@data-gadget-url='&#36;runner_url}gadget_erp5_searchfield.html']</td>
<td></td>
</tr>
<!-- Type search query and submit using button -->
......@@ -46,7 +46,7 @@
</tr>
<tr>
<td>click</td>
<td>//div[@data-gadget-url='${runner_url}gadget_erp5_panel.html']//div[@data-gadget-url='${runner_url}gadget_erp5_searchfield.html']//button[@type='submit']</td>
<td>//div[@data-gadget-url='&#36;runner_url}gadget_erp5_panel.html']//div[@data-gadget-url='&#36;runner_url}gadget_erp5_searchfield.html']//button[@type='submit']</td>
<td></td>
</tr>
<tal:block metal:use-macro="here/Zuite_CommonTemplateForRenderjsUi/macros/wait_for_listbox_loaded" />
......@@ -54,12 +54,12 @@
<!-- Verify that panel search query is empty but main search input is not -->
<tr>
<td>waitForElementPresent</td>
<td>//div[@data-gadget-url='${runner_url}gadget_erp5_panel.html']//div[@data-gadget-url='${runner_url}gadget_erp5_searchfield.html']</td>
<td>//div[@data-gadget-url='&#36;runner_url}gadget_erp5_panel.html']//div[@data-gadget-url='&#36;runner_url}gadget_erp5_searchfield.html']</td>
<td></td>
</tr>
<tr>
<td>verifyValue</td>
<td>//div[@data-gadget-url='${runner_url}gadget_erp5_panel.html']//div[@data-gadget-url='${runner_url}gadget_erp5_searchfield.html']//input[@name='search']</td>
<td>//div[@data-gadget-url='&#36;runner_url}gadget_erp5_panel.html']//div[@data-gadget-url='&#36;runner_url}gadget_erp5_searchfield.html']//input[@name='search']</td>
<td></td>
</tr>
<tal:block tal:define="search_query python: 'Title 1';
......
......@@ -24,7 +24,7 @@
<!-- No default sort -->
<tal:block metal:use-macro="here/Zuite_CommonTemplateForRenderjsUi/macros/triggle_sort" />
<tr><td>assertElementNotP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_sort_editor.html']//select</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_sort_editor.html']//select</td><td></td></tr>
<!-- Change the default sort -->
<tr>
......@@ -89,7 +89,7 @@
<!-- No default sort -->
<tal:block metal:use-macro="here/Zuite_CommonTemplateForRenderjsUi/macros/triggle_sort" />
<tr><td>assertElementNotP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_sort_editor.html']//select</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_sort_editor.html']//select</td><td></td></tr>
</tbody></table>
......
......@@ -60,7 +60,7 @@
</tr>
<tal:block metal:use-macro="here/Zuite_CommonTemplateForRenderjsUi/macros/triggle_sort" />
<tr><td>assertElementNotPresent</td>
<td>//div[@data-gadget-url='${renderjs_url}/gadget_erp5_sort_editor.html']//select</td><td></td></tr>
<td>//div[@data-gadget-url='&#36;renderjs_url}/gadget_erp5_sort_editor.html']//select</td><td></td></tr>
<!-- Go to another page than search -->
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ment